Natural born killers: NK cells drafted into the cancer fight.

Once thought of as foot soldiers in the body's fight against cancer, natural killer (NK) cells are more akin to special forces in bolstering the immune system to respond to foreign invaders. New studies are revealing that rather than randomly killing cells—as was thought for many years—NK cells are programmed to seek out specific targets on cancer cells. Certain protein transducing agents convert translocated proteins into cell killers.

The majority of proteins are unable to translocate into the cell interior. Hence for peptide- and protein-based therapeutics a direct intracytoplasmic delivery with the aid of transducing agents is an attractive approach. Killing the killers

The bacteria that infect humans and cause cholera are themselves infected by viruses, which have the potential to influence the course of a cholera infection.

Preterm Cognitive Function Into Adulthood.

BACKGROUND Very preterm (VP; gestational age <32 weeks) and very low birth weight (VLBW; <1500 g) births are related to impaired cognitive function across the life span. It is not known how stable cognitive functions are from childhood to adulthood for VP/VLBW compared with term-born individuals and how early adult cognitive function can be predicted.
